Asian Barbecued Turkey Lettuce Wrap

A great appetizer for a casual spring or summer dinner.

Ready In: 30 mins

Serves: 10

Directions

  1. Over medium heat, crumble turkey into a wok or large skillet and sauté, stirring to break up any clumps. Cook until lightly browned.
  2. Stir in hoisin and barbecue sauces, gingerroot and garlic. Cook until hot and well blended. Mix pine nuts, scallions and crystallized ginger, tossing gently just long enough to heat through and blend well.
  3. To serve, spoon the hot turkey mixture into each lettuce leaf cup and roll tightly to enclose the turkey mixture.
  4. NOTE:
  5. This is a delightful casual party food. Your guests will enjoy rolling their own appetizers.
  6. Makes 10 servings (1 wrap containing approximately 1 ounce cooked turkey).
